The Operating Cash Flow of Max Power Mining (MAXX.CN) as of Aug 16, 2026 is -8.13 M CAD. In the previous year, Operating Cash Flow was -3.24 M CAD — a change of 151.37% (lower).

Operating cash flow measures the cash generated from core business operations. It is a pure measure of a company's ability to generate cash.
